16 And they were both troubled, and fell upon their faces; for they were afraid. (WEB) 17 And he said to them, “Don’t be afraid. You will all have peace; but bless God forever. (WEB) 18 For I came not of any favor of my own, but by the will of your God. Therefore bless him forever. (WEB)
Tobit 12:16–18
